Je. Eldridge et al., RESONANT RAMAN-SCATTERING AND ELECTRON-PHONON COUPLING IN THE ORGANICSUPERCONDUCTOR (BEDT-TTF)(2)[CU(NCS)(2)], Synthetic metals, 86(1-3), 1997, pp. 2067-2068
The frequency shifts of the Ag modes, which appear in the infrared con
ductivity of x-(ET)(2)[Cu(NCS)(2)], are due to electron-phonon couplin
g and have been measured by comparing the infrared spectrum with the r
esonant Raman spectrum obtained with an infrared laser. The agreement
with calculated values is very good.
